C#调用webservice服务超时

 时间:2024-10-15 18:01:03

1、首先修改服务端配置WebService服务所在站点为服务端,它提供了服务,打开这个站点的web.config,添加下面的配置: <httpRuntime executionTimeout="300000" /><compilation defaultLanguage="c#" debug="false">executionTimeout="300000" 单位是“毫秒”,这里配置的是5分钟。debug="false" 要关闭调试。如果web.config中本来就有这两个配置,修改一下就行了。如果没有,就添加上去,完整的结构顺序如下:<configuration> <system.web> <httpRuntime executionTimeout="300000" /> <compilation defaultLanguage="c#" debug="false"> </compilation> </system.web></configuration>

2、修改调用程序客户端的配置YourService. YourService model = new YourService. YourService ();model.Timeout = 300000; // 单位是毫秒,设置时间,否则时间超限这里给服务对象model设置超时时间Timeout为300000毫秒。

  • windows的日志怎么查看
  • 电击文库零境交错桐人攻略
  • fiddler怎么通过域名过滤抓包内容
  • Windows Server2012专用网络不阻止所有传入连接
  • 阿玛拉王国惩罚存档修改器怎么用
  • 热门搜索
    广州旅游攻略自助游 去海南旅游攻略 南京旅游景点大全介绍 旅游论坛排名 福州有哪些旅游景点 驰誉欢途旅游网 曼谷芭提雅旅游攻略 印尼巴厘岛旅游攻略 广西龙脊梯田旅游攻略 旅游作文100字